
Closing Bell Overtime: Anduril Co-Founder On Raising A New Round; Claudia Sahm On If Sahm Rule Is Being Overused 8/14/24
Anduril co-founder Trae Stephens talks the company’s new factory and its latest funding round. Former Fed economist Claudia Sahm on if her rule, the Sahm rule, is being overused by investors right now. Plus, The Hartford CEO Christopher Swift on the continued rise in insurance costs and our Phil LeBeua gives the latest on the Southwest activist battle with Elliott Management.
